Around the smokeshaft. Building ordinance need that air rooms between smokeshafts and floor or ceiling settings up through which they pass be secured with a non-combustible fire quit (see Figure 5-3 and Figure 5-4). After air sealing, attic room air flow is your second line of protection versus the water vapour that may have found its means right into the attic. It guarantees a cooler, well-vented attic room space much less susceptible to the formation of ice dams at the eaves.

You might have to locate roof covering or soffit vents from outside if they are not plainly visible from inside the attic room. Houses with peaked roofs and obtainable attics are the most convenient to air vent by utilizing the proportion of 1 to 300. This ratio describes unhampered vent location to the insulated ceiling area.

Do not make use of electric exhaust fans for attic room air flow as these can draw much more air than can be supplied through the soffit vents. This will in fact draw home air into the attic room, leading to greater warmth loss and wetness build-up. They are likewise prone to failing, noise manufacturing and raised power usage.

If the attic room retrofit is being completed along with indoor remodellings, the easiest approach is to set up a new, solitary air and vapour obstacle on the underside of the ceiling joists.


The primary difficulty with this method involves securing the barrier to the wall surface top plate, specifically at the eaves where there is little space to manoeuvre. This location should be well secured. Spray foam or rigid board insulation can help link the space around. Spray foam service providers can install closed-cell foam in between the joists to air seal and include insulation at the very same time to the ceiling. All existing insulation and dirt must be eliminated initially to permit a good bond. A minimum of 50 mm (2 in.) is needed; top up with other insulation afterwards.

If there are obstructions above the joists, such as with a truss roofing, it might be easiest to put batt insulation right into the joist rooms and after that use loose-fill insulation to create a full blanket of insulation over the joists and around all blockages. Loose-fill insulation is also great by itself, particularly in uneven or blocked rooms.

Fill up all nooks and crannies. At the eaves, do not block the air flow. Protect against insulation from going away onto the vented soffits of the eave room by setting up a piece of stiff board insulation or a wood baffle prior to the work begins. Building-supply shops offer cardboard or foam plastic baffles that can be stapled between the rafters (see Number 5-11).


If the loosened fill is deeper than the joists, build insulation structure (a crib) around the attic room hatch so that it can be loaded to the edge (see Number 4-7). The bags of insulation material will provide the number of square metres (or square feet) each bag should cover to supply the required RSI worth.

If you are having a professional do the job, calculate the RSI value that you want and examine the bags of insulation to be used. They ought to suggest the location that bag will certainly cover at the selected protecting worth. You and the professional must after that agree on the complete number of bags to be used, the expected protecting worth and the minimal settled depth of insulation throughout the attic, based upon a details thickness.
